TED Talk Questions

Watch and Learn!


A. Answer the questions below based on the speech from TED Talk that you have
watched.

1. What is grit?
Grit is having passion and perseverance for having very long term goals, grit
is having stamina, Grit is sticking with your future. Grit means having passion
on what we are doing, the passion of learning, working, getting a life that we
desire. Grit doesn’t mean having a greet IQ what we just need is the passion
on being successful or the perseverance to become the best. Basically what
I understand is Grit means to just not give up, to learn and accept that we
aren’t great in math or some other things but having grit means that we can
still change that mindset of ours if we only work hard and give effort to doing
it.
2. How to build or develop grit among kids or students?
That talent is not needed. The best idea is growth mindset.
3. What is growth mindset?
Growth mindset is the belief that the ability of learning/ learn is not fixed or
stable. That it can be change or change with the help of our passion to learn
and effort.
4. Why is growth mindset believed to be a good way to develop grit?
It is believed to be a good way to develop grit because at a young age it
shows kids to not look at the bad side of failing but to actually look at it as a
good way of us learning something. It changes the idea of “when I fail I won’t
come back from this” to “when I fail it’s alright at least I know what to do or to
correct my error.” Growth mindset is actually a good way to develop grit
because it tells students, anyone to never give up that our mind is capable of
changing or is capable of adapting that we are allowed to fail because with
us failing we will know how to correct our errors and still persever in our life.
